Comprehensive Definitions & Senses
2 senses- 1
A high-speed highway in Germany, designed for fast-moving traffic with no general speed limit.
"Driving on the autobahn can be an exhilarating experience due to the lack of speed limits in certain areas." - 2
Any similar high-speed roadway in other countries, often inspired by the German autobahn system.
"The new expressway was designed to function like an autobahn, allowing for faster travel between major cities."

Linguistic Origin & Historical Etymology
The term 'Autobahn' originates from the German language, where 'Auto' means 'car' and 'Bahn' means 'way' or 'road'. It was first used in the early 20th century to describe high-speed roadways designed for motor vehicles, reflecting the advancements in automotive technology and the growing need for efficient transportation networks.

View all stories →How Are Palisade Cells Adapted for Photosynthesis (and Why Are They Called 'Palisade')?
Palisade mesophyll cells are column-shaped, densely packed with chloroplasts, and positioned near the leaf's upper surface to maximize light absorption for photosynthesis. Their name comes from the French word for a defensive fence of wooden stakes, referencing their tightly aligned, upright cellular structure.
